The valuable BIE pennies are those that show a small vertical die crack taking the approximate form of a capital letter I between the B and E of LIBERTY on the obverse. The British decimal one penny (1p) coin is a unit of currency and denomination of sterling coinage worth 1 100 of one pound.Its obverse featured the profile of Queen Elizabeth II since the coin's introduction on 15 February 1971, the day British currency was decimalised until her death on 8 September 2022.A new portrait featuring King Charles III was introduced on 30 September 2022 . Answer (1 of 29): With the exception of the WW II years USA pennies from the 1860's through 1981 were an alloy of about 95% copper and 5% tin and/or zinc.
